Id Obits Forum Reply Here: http://cgi.rootsweb.com/~genbbs/genbbs.cgi/USA/Id/FranklinObits/10306 Surname: Beutler, Johnson, Hulse ------------------------- The Idaho State Journal 05-06-2001 DAYTON — Mary Pearl Johnson Beutler, 91, passed away Saturday, May 5, 2001, at her son's home in Dayton, Idaho. She was born Aug. 24, 1909, in Hyrum, Utah, to Niels Albert and Amy Maud Hulse Johnson. She served an LDS Mission to the Northern States and taught school in Mendon. She married Ernest Felix Beutler on June 16, 1938, in the Logan, Utah Temple. She was an active member of the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ints where she served as Stake Relief Society president. She also enjoyed doing extraction work. She loved to read and work in the garden and yard. She tied quilts for her grandchildren. She raised nine children and was a wonderful mother. She is survived by six sons and three daughters, Mark (Joyce) Beutler, Mapleton, Utah; Lloyd (Kandis) Beutler, Plain City, Utah; Ruth Ann (Morris) Gregory, Preston, Idaho; Ivan (Lucy) Beutler, Provo, Utah; Ione (Jay) Fowkes, Coalinga, California; Melvin (Carol) Beutler, Dayton; Lois (Joel) Palmer, Monticello, Utah; Wesley (Roxane) Beutler, Dayton; Garth (Joyce) Beutler, Ogden, Utah; 63 grandchildren, 43 great-grandchildren, four sisters and one brother, Lorraine Willis, Reno, Nevada; June Stevenson, Reno, Nevada; Reed (Dorene) Johnson, Logan, Utah; Carol (Elmer) Jones, Stony Creek, Connecticut; and Alda Lee (Denton) Hall, Plain City, Utah. She was preceded in death by her husband, Ernest, by five grandchildren, two great-grandchildren, three brothers and five sisters. Funeral services will be held at 1 p.m. on Tuesday, May 8, 2001, in the Dayton Ward Chapel with Bishop Ronald Atkinson conducting. Friends may call Monday from 6 p.m. to 8 p.m. at Webb Funeral Home and Tuesday from 11:30 a.m. to 12:30 p.m. at the church. Interment will be in the Dayton Idaho Cemetery.
